namespace test
{
// Note that the default hash function will work for any equal_to (but not
// very well).
class object;
class hash;
class less;
class equal_to;
template <class T> class allocator;
object generate(object const*);
class object : globally_counted_object
{
friend class hash;
friend class equal_to;
friend class less;
int tag1_, tag2_;
public:
explicit object(int t1 = 0, int t2 = 0) : tag1_(t1), tag2_(t2) {}
~object() {
tag1_ = -1;
tag2_ = -1;
}
friend bool operator==(object const& x1, object const& x2) {
return x1.tag1_ == x2.tag1_ && x1.tag2_ == x2.tag2_;
}
friend bool operator!=(object const& x1, object const& x2) {
return x1.tag1_ != x2.tag1_ || x1.tag2_ != x2.tag2_;
}
friend bool operator<(object const& x1, object const& x2) {
return x1.tag1_ < x2.tag1_ ||
(x1.tag1_ == x2.tag1_ && x1.tag2_ < x2.tag2_);
}
friend object generate(object const*) {
int* x = 0;
return object(generate(x), generate(x));
}
friend std::ostream& operator<<(std::ostream& out, object const& o)
{
return out<<"("<<o.tag1_<<","<<o.tag2_<<")";
}
};
class hash
{
int type_;
public:
explicit hash(int t = 0) : type_(t) {}
std::size_t operator()(object const& x) const {
switch(type_) {
case 1:
return x.tag1_;
case 2:
return x.tag2_;
default:
return x.tag1_ + x.tag2_;
}
}
std::size_t operator()(int x) const {
return x;
}
friend bool operator==(hash const& x1, hash const& x2) {
return x1.type_ == x2.type_;
}
friend bool operator!=(hash const& x1, hash const& x2) {
return x1.type_ != x2.type_;
}
};
class less
{
int type_;
public:
explicit less(int t = 0) : type_(t) {}
bool operator()(object const& x1, object const& x2) const {
switch(type_) {
case 1:
return x1.tag1_ < x2.tag1_;
case 2:
return x1.tag2_ < x2.tag2_;
default:
return x1 < x2;
}
}
std::size_t operator()(int x1, int x2) const {
return x1 < x2;
}
friend bool operator==(less const& x1, less const& x2) {
return x1.type_ == x2.type_;
}
};
class equal_to
{
int type_;
public:
explicit equal_to(int t = 0) : type_(t) {}
bool operator()(object const& x1, object const& x2) const {
switch(type_) {
case 1:
return x1.tag1_ == x2.tag1_;
case 2:
return x1.tag2_ == x2.tag2_;
default:
return x1 == x2;
}
}
std::size_t operator()(int x1, int x2) const {
return x1 == x2;
}
friend bool operator==(equal_to const& x1, equal_to const& x2) {
return x1.type_ == x2.type_;
}
friend bool operator!=(equal_to const& x1, equal_to const& x2) {
return x1.type_ != x2.type_;
}
friend less create_compare(equal_to x) {
return less(x.type_);
}
};
